数据库是根据数据模型、数据管理系统、硬件系统、软件系统以及企业业务需求建立的。数据模型定义了数据的组织形式和操作方式,它包括实体-关系模型、面向对象模型、层次模型、网状模型等。数据库的建立需要选择合适的数据模型。数据管理系统是数据库的核心,包括数据库管理系统(DBMS)和数据仓库系统,它负责数据的存储、查询、更新等操作。硬件系统提供了运行数据库的物理设施,包括服务器、存储设备、网络设备等。软件系统是数据库运行的平台,包括操作系统、数据库软件、应用软件等。企业业务需求是数据库建立的直接原因,数据库应满足企业的信息管理需求,提供决策支持。
接下来,我们将对这些因素进行详细的分析。
一、数据模型
数据模型是数据库建立的基础,它定义了数据的组织形式和操作方式。数据模型的选择影响数据库的性能、灵活性、易用性等方面。常见的数据模型包括实体-关系模型、面向对象模型、层次模型、网状模型等。
二、数据管理系统
数据管理系统是数据库的核心,它负责数据的存储、查询、更新等操作。数据管理系统包括数据库管理系统(DBMS)和数据仓库系统。DBMS是数据库的操作和控制系统,它提供数据的存储、查询、更新、安全控制等功能。数据仓库系统是大规模、长期存储数据的系统,它提供数据的集成、清洗、转换、加载等功能。
三、硬件系统
硬件系统提供了运行数据库的物理设施,包括服务器、存储设备、网络设备等。硬件系统的性能、可靠性、容量、扩展性等因素影响数据库的性能和稳定性。
四、软件系统
软件系统是数据库运行的平台,它包括操作系统、数据库软件、应用软件等。操作系统提供了运行数据库的环境,包括文件系统、内存管理、进程管理、设备管理等功能。数据库软件提供了操作和管理数据库的工具,包括SQL语言、数据定义语言、数据操作语言、数据控制语言等。应用软件是用户使用数据库的工具,它提供了数据查询、报表生成、数据分析等功能。
五、企业业务需求
企业业务需求是数据库建立的直接原因,数据库应满足企业的信息管理需求,提供决策支持。企业业务需求影响数据库的结构、功能、性能等方面。例如,一家电商公司需要一个商品数据库,它应包含商品的基本信息、库存信息、销售信息等,并支持查询、更新、统计、预测等操作。
相关问答FAQs:
数据库是根据什么建立的?
数据库是根据数据模型建立的。数据模型是数据库设计的基础,它定义了数据之间的关系和结构。常见的数据模型包括层次模型、网络模型、关系模型、面向对象模型等。其中,关系模型是最常用的数据模型,它使用表格来组织数据,表格中的每一行代表一个记录,每一列代表一个属性。通过定义表格之间的关系,可以建立起一个有结构、有组织的数据库。
除了数据模型,数据库还需要有数据库管理系统(DBMS)来管理和操作数据。DBMS是一种软件,它可以通过提供查询语言、数据存储和检索功能、数据安全性控制等功能,帮助用户对数据库进行管理和操作。
在建立数据库之前,需要进行数据库设计。数据库设计包括确定数据库的目标和需求、确定数据模型、设计表格结构、定义表格之间的关系等。数据库设计的质量直接影响数据库的性能、可扩展性和可维护性。
总之,数据库是根据数据模型建立的,而数据库设计则是建立数据库的重要环节。
文章标题:数据库是根据什么建立的,发布者:不及物动词,转载请注明出处:https://worktile.com/kb/p/2916617